Situations Vacant Situations Vacant PRINCIPAL FLOCK HOUSE FARM TRAINING INSTITUTE BULLS VACANCY NO: 981 APPLICATIONS ARE INVITED for the position o: Principal at Flock House. Flock House is 14 kilometres south-west ol Bulls and 42 kilometres from the city of Palmerston North. Flock House is a national institute for the education aand training of primary industry people al the tertiary level and is administered' bv the Advisory Services Division of the Ministry of Agriculture and Fisheries. Flock House has a total area of 1420 ha. The property is divided into a number of economic farm units which are operated as commercial enterprises and are used to support the teaching offered. Flock House is well equipped with modern educational, recreational and accommodation facilities. The Principal is responsible for the overall operation of the Institute. RESEARCH OFFICER THE HOUSING CORPORATION OF NEW ZEALAND (which services the R.B.F.C. research requirements) requires a Research Officer to undertake R.B.F.C. research projects. The vacancy is in the Research and Evaluation Unit at our head office in Wellington. This is a well established unit which conducts studies of economic aspects of R.B.F.C. lending. The position would involve research into the economic and financial aspects of rural lending with a special emphasis on monitoring and forecasting trends on income, production and financing within the agricultural, horticultural and fishing industries, as well as investigating the impact and effects of the lending policies of the R.B.F.C. This position could be rewarding for a person with a degree specialising in economics, farm management. agricultural science, business studies or commerce. Excellent working conditions and prospects.
